Formula to convert terabyte to megabyte
To convert terabyte to megabyte, multiply by 1000000.
1 TB = 1000000 MB
Example: 1 terabyte = 1000000 megabyte
Common mistakes
-
Drive makers count in decimal: 1 TB = 1,000 GB = 10¹² bytes. Operating systems often display binary units (powers of 1,024), so the same drive shows up as about 931 'GB', really gibibytes (GiB). The 'missing' 69 gigabytes are just two counting systems, nothing is lost.
-
A byte is 8 bits, and the abbreviations differ only in letter case: lowercase b for bits (Mbit), uppercase B for bytes (MB). Broadband is sold in megabits per second while files are measured in megabytes. Mixing them up makes every figure wrong by a factor of eight.
